How to Choose the Right Bralette
The best bralette is not necessarily the most decorative or heavily padded option. It is the one that suits your body, intended outfit, desired silhouette, and comfort level.
Start With the Band Measurement
The underband does most of the work in a wireless bralette. It should feel secure without digging into your skin or rolling upward. Always compare your measurements with the individual Amazon sellerโs sizing chart because sizing can vary considerably between brands.
Avoid relying only on your usual T-shirt size. One brandโs large may fit like another brandโs medium, especially when a product uses Asian, European, or unisex sizing.
Decide How Much Shape You Want
Choose an unpadded or lightly lined design when you want a natural, subtle appearance. Select removable padding when you want more control over the shape.
For breast forms or larger inserts, look for internal pockets and a wider underband. A very delicate bralette may look beautiful but may not provide enough support to hold heavier forms securely.
Consider Your Clothing
A seamless bralette works best beneath fitted tops because lace and decorative seams may show through thin fabrics. Lace, longline, and strappy styles are better when the bralette is part of the visible outfit.
Also consider the neckline. Triangle cups usually complement lower necklines, while fuller-coverage bralettes are often easier to wear beneath ordinary T-shirts and blouses.
Common Bralette Buying Mistakes
Choosing Appearance Over Comfort
A highly decorative bralette may look stunning in photographs but become uncomfortable after an hour. Check customer reviews for comments about scratchy fabric, tight bands, rough seams, and straps that dig into the shoulders.
Buying a Band That Is Too Small
Many shoppers size down because they expect a bralette to create strong support. However, an overly tight band can roll, pinch, and make the bralette difficult to put on.
The band should stay in place without restricting comfortable breathing or movement.
Expecting Push-Up Bra Support
Most bralettes are designed for light support and comfort rather than dramatic lift. Padding can create shape, but a wireless bralette will not always produce the same cleavage as a structured push-up bra.
Choose according to the productโs purpose instead of expecting every style to provide identical results.
Ignoring the Care Instructions
Lace, removable padding, and delicate elastic can lose their shape when washed aggressively. Hand washing or using a lingerie bag on a gentle cycle can help the bralette last longer.
Remove foam pads before washing when the manufacturer recommends it, and reshape them before placing them back inside the cups.
Frequently Asked Questions
Are bralettes suitable for beginners?
Yes. Their soft construction, flexible sizing, and lack of underwire make bralettes one of the easiest lingerie styles for beginners. A seamless or adjustable design is usually the most approachable first choice.
Can I wear a bralette without breast forms?
Absolutely. Bralettes can be worn for comfort, layering, style, or the feminine feeling they provide. Light padding can create a subtle outline even without additional inserts.
Can bralettes hold breast forms?
Some can, but pocketed bralettes are the safest choice. Ordinary bralettes may hold lightweight inserts, although heavier forms usually require stronger bands, fuller cups, and dedicated internal pockets.
Should I choose padded or unpadded cups?
Choose padding when you want more shape, nipple coverage, or a smoother appearance beneath clothing. Choose unpadded cups when softness, breathability, and a natural silhouette are more important.
Can I sleep in a bralette?
A soft wireless bralette may be comfortable enough for sleeping, particularly when it has no hooks, wires, rough lace, or thick hardware. Avoid anything that feels restrictive while lying down.
How should a bralette fit?
The band should remain level around your torso without digging in or sliding upward. The cups should sit smoothly without excessive gaping, and the straps should stay in place without pressing painfully into the shoulders.
Are longline bralettes more supportive?
They can feel more secure because the wider band distributes pressure across a larger area. However, actual support still depends on the fabric strength, cup construction, closure, and quality of the elastic.
How do I hide a bralette beneath clothing?
Choose smooth fabric, minimal seams, and a colour close to your skin tone or clothing. Avoid raised lace, decorative straps, and thick cup edges beneath tight or lightweight tops.
How often should I wash a bralette?
Wash it after one to three wears depending on temperature, activity, and perspiration. Gentle washing protects the elastic and helps prevent the fabric from losing its softness and shape.
